Automated banking machine and system
First Claim
1. A cash dispensing automated banking machine that operates responsive to data read from user cards, comprising:
- at least one computer in the automated banking machine, wherein the at least one computer is programmed to receive at least one markup language document from at least one server, wherein the at least one markup language document specifies a keymap;
a plurality of transaction function devices in supporting connection with the machine, wherein the plurality of transaction function devices include a cash dispenser and a card reader;
a display screen in supporting connection with the machine; and
at least one resource in supporting connection with the machine, wherein the at least one resource includes a keypad including a plurality of keys in supporting connection with the automated banking machine;
wherein the at least one computer is operative responsive to the keymap specified by the at least one markup language document and responsive to configuration data accessed by the automated banking machine, to selectively enable a subset of keys of the keypad to be capable of receiving manual inputs operative to cause the automated banking machine to carry out at least a portion of a banking transaction.
4 Assignments
0 Petitions
Accused Products
Abstract
A cash dispensing automated banking machine that operates in response to data read from user cards includes a cash dispenser, keypad, and a card reader. The card reader is operative to read data bearing records such as user cards that include financial account information. At least one computer in the automated banking machine is responsive to a keymap specified by at least one markup language document and is responsive to configuration data accessed by the automated banking machine, to selectively enable a subset of keys of the keypad to be capable of providing inputs operative to cause the automated banking machine to carry out a portion of a banking transaction.
23 Citations
18 Claims
-
1. A cash dispensing automated banking machine that operates responsive to data read from user cards, comprising:
-
at least one computer in the automated banking machine, wherein the at least one computer is programmed to receive at least one markup language document from at least one server, wherein the at least one markup language document specifies a keymap; a plurality of transaction function devices in supporting connection with the machine, wherein the plurality of transaction function devices include a cash dispenser and a card reader; a display screen in supporting connection with the machine; and at least one resource in supporting connection with the machine, wherein the at least one resource includes a keypad including a plurality of keys in supporting connection with the automated banking machine; wherein the at least one computer is operative responsive to the keymap specified by the at least one markup language document and responsive to configuration data accessed by the automated banking machine, to selectively enable a subset of keys of the keypad to be capable of receiving manual inputs operative to cause the automated banking machine to carry out at least a portion of a banking transaction. - View Dependent Claims (2, 3, 7, 14, 15)
-
-
4. A cash dispensing automated banking machine that operates responsive to data read from user cards, comprising:
-
at least one computer in the automated banking machine, wherein the at least one computer is operatively programmed to receive at least one markup language document from at least one server, wherein the at least one markup language document specifies a keymap; a plurality of transaction function devices in operatively supported connection with the machine, wherein the plurality of transaction function devices include a cash dispenser and a card reader; a display screen in operatively supported connection with the machine; and at least one resource in operatively supported connection with the machine, wherein the at least one resource includes a keypad including a plurality of keys in supporting connection with the automated banking machine; wherein the at least one computer is operative, responsive to the keymap specified by the at least one markup language document and responsive to configuration data accessed by the automated banking machine, to selectively enable a subset of keys of the keypad to be capable of receiving manual inputs operative to cause the automated banking machine to carry out at least a portion of a banking transaction, wherein the configuration data further includes conversion data usable by the at least one computer to convert keypad input signals to at least one of keyboard input stream signals and mouse input stream signals. - View Dependent Claims (5, 6)
-
-
8. A cash dispensing automated banking machine that operates responsive to data read from user cards, comprising:
-
at least one computer in the automated banking machine; a display screen in supporting connection with the automated banking machine; a cash dispenser in supporting connection with the automated banking machine; a card reader in supporting connection with the automated banking machine; wherein the at least one computer is programmed to receive configuration data from at least one server, which configuration data is associated with at least one of a plurality of resources included in the machine; wherein the at least one computer is programmed to receive at least one markup language document from the at least one server, wherein the at least one markup language document includes application instructions; wherein the at least one computer is programmed to correlate at least one portion of the application instructions to the at least one resource of the automated banking machine responsive to the configuration data; and wherein the at least one computer is programmed to cause the automated banking machine to carry out at least a portion of a banking transaction responsive to the application instructions, which banking transaction includes operation of the at least one correlated resource. - View Dependent Claims (9, 10, 16, 17, 18)
-
-
11. A cash dispensing automated banking machine that operates responsive to data read from user cards, comprising:
-
at least one computer in the automated banking machine; a display screen in operatively supported connection with the automated banking machine; a cash dispenser in operatively supported connection with the automated banking machine; a card reader in operatively supported connection with the automated banking machine; a keypad in operatively supported connection with the automated banking machine, wherein the keypad includes a plurality of keys; wherein the at least one computer is operatively programmed to receive configuration data from at least one server, wherein the configuration data includes conversion data usable by the at least one computer to convert keypad input signals to at least one of keyboard input stream signals and mouse input stream signals, wherein the configuration data includes a plurality of sets of data usable by the at least one computer to selectively enable respective subsets of keys of the keypad, wherein each subset includes at least one key, wherein each set of data is associated with a respective keymap; wherein the at least one computer is operatively programmed to receive at least one markup language document from the at least one server, wherein the at least one markup language document includes application instructions, wherein the at least one portion of the application instructions specifies a keymap; wherein the at least one computer is operatively programmed to correlate the specified keymap with one of the subsets including at least one of the keys of the keypad responsive to the configuration data; wherein the at least one computer is programmed to cause the automated banking machine to carry out at least a portion of a banking transaction responsive to the application instructions and at least one input signal generated responsive to at least one key of the one subset being manually operated by a user. - View Dependent Claims (12, 13)
-
Specification